The High-Stakes Clash at Arun Jaitley Stadium

The Indian Premier League (IPL) 2026 season reaches a boiling point this Sunday, May 17, as the Delhi Capitals (DC) host the Rajasthan Royals (RR) in Match 62. As the tournament enters its final group stage stretch, every delivery becomes critical, and for both sides, the margin for error has effectively vanished.

Delhi Capitals: Fighting to Stay Alive

The road for the Delhi Capitals has been fraught with inconsistency. Currently sitting in seventh place with five wins from twelve matches, the side led by Axar Patel is staring at a mathematical miracle. To keep their flickering playoff aspirations burning, they must secure victories in their final two fixtures. The pressure is immense, yet it often brings out the best in talented rosters. KL Rahul has been the standout performer, accumulating 477 runs at an impressive average of 43, providing stability at the top. However, the team requires more from the middle order, including Tristan Stubbs, David Miller, and Nitish Rana. On the bowling front, the presence of veterans like Mitchell Starc and Lungi Ngidi has not yielded the expected dominance, while Kuldeep Yadav remains under pressure to regain his wicket-taking form.

Rajasthan Royals: Seeking Redemption

The Rajasthan Royals find themselves in a precarious position after a mid-season slump. Despite a blistering start that saw them topple heavyweights like the Mumbai Indians and Chennai Super Kings, they have lost five of their last seven outings. Now in sixth place, the Royals are desperate to rediscover their winning formula. Yashasvi Jaiswal is expected to lead the side in the absence of Riyan Parag, hoping to reignite the form that saw him become a focal point of the team’s early success. The batting lineup, featuring the likes of Vaibhav Sooryavanshi, Shimron Hetmyer, and Ravindra Jadeja, must transition from promising starts to match-winning totals. Jofra Archer continues to be the spearhead of the bowling unit, supported by Tushar Deshpande and a likely returning Ravi Bishnoi.

Venue and Conditions: What to Expect

The Arun Jaitley Stadium is renowned for being a batter’s paradise. The surface is typically firm and flat, ideal for strokemaking, with short boundaries further favoring the hitters. While the average first-innings score of 172 suggests a high-scoring encounter, the pitch often offers some grip to spinners during the middle overs. Given the extreme heat in Delhi, with evening temperatures hovering between 36-38°C, humidity will be a factor, though the heat itself will test the players’ endurance throughout the 40 overs.

Tactical Insights and Predictions

The powerplay will likely dictate the outcome of this match. Rajasthan’s top order, led by Jaiswal and Sooryavanshi, is statistically one of the strongest in the early overs. Conversely, the Delhi Capitals must navigate this period without losing early wickets to stay competitive. Our analysis suggests that if the Delhi spinners, Axar Patel and Kuldeep Yadav, can exploit the surface effectively, they may tilt the scales in favor of the hosts. While the Rajasthan Royals possess immense individual talent, the urgency of the situation and the home advantage suggest a win for the Delhi Capitals.
